Understanding the workings of a septic system is essential in order to prevent clogs and maintain its optimal functioning. Septic system components play a crucial role in the overall operation of the system.
A typical septic system consists of a septic tank, a drainfield, and soil. The septic tank acts as a primary treatment unit where solid waste settles to the bottom and forms a layer of sludge, while lighter materials such as oils and fats float to the top, creating a layer of scum. The middle layer, known as effluent, is made up of liquid waste that flows into the drainfield for further treatment.
The drainfield, also known as the leach field, is composed of a series of perforated pipes buried in trenches filled with gravel or sand. This is where the effluent is dispersed and undergoes natural filtration through the soil.
Proper septic system installation is crucial to ensure efficient functioning and prevent future problems. During installation, it is important to consider factors such as soil type, site topography, and local regulations. The septic tank should be placed in a location that allows easy accessibility for maintenance and pumping. The drainfield should be situated in an area with suitable soil characteristics, such as good drainage and low water table.
It is also important to ensure proper sizing of the septic system according to the number of household occupants and their water usage. Adequate space should be allocated for the drainfield to ensure proper wastewater treatment and prevent overloading.
Following these guidelines during installation can help promote the longevity and effectiveness of the septic system, reducing the likelihood of clogs and other issues.
Regular maintenance and inspections are crucial in ensuring the proper functioning and longevity of a septic system, providing homeowners with peace of mind and avoiding potential costly and inconvenient issues.
A well-maintained septic system requires a regular maintenance schedule that includes tasks such as pumping the tank, checking for leaks or damage, and inspecting the drainfield. By following a maintenance schedule, homeowners can prevent the accumulation of solids in the tank, which can lead to clogs and backups. Regular pumping of the tank removes the solids that settle at the bottom, allowing the system to function efficiently. Additionally, checking for leaks or damage is important to catch any issues early on and prevent further damage. This can involve inspecting the pipes, valves, and fittings for any signs of wear or deterioration. By addressing these issues promptly, homeowners can avoid more extensive repairs or replacements in the future.
In addition to regular maintenance, professional inspections are essential for the proper care of a septic system. These inspections should be conducted by a qualified septic professional who can assess the overall condition of the system and identify any potential problems. Inspections typically involve a thorough examination of the tank, drainfield, and associated components to ensure they are functioning properly. The septic professional may also perform tests to evaluate the drainage and absorption capabilities of the drainfield. By having regular professional inspections, homeowners can catch any issues early on and implement necessary repairs or maintenance to prevent further damage.
Professional inspections provide homeowners with expert knowledge and guidance, helping them make informed decisions about the maintenance and care of their septic system. Overall, regular maintenance and professional inspections are crucial for homeowners to keep their septic systems clog-free and ensure the long-term functionality and reliability of their septic systems.

Implementing preventative measures is crucial for maintaining the integrity and functionality of the drainfield. One of the primary causes of drainfield damage is the infiltration of roots from nearby trees and shrubs. These roots can penetrate the pipes and cause blockages, leading to drainfield repair or even septic tank backup. To prevent this, it is important to carefully consider the location of your drainfield when planting trees and shrubs on your property. Keep them at a safe distance from the drainfield area to minimize the risk of root intrusion.
Additionally, regular inspections by a professional can help identify and address any potential issues before they escalate into major problems. By proactively taking these measures, you can significantly reduce the likelihood of drainfield damage and ensure the smooth operation of your septic system.
Another common cause of drainfield damage is excessive water usage. When the drainfield becomes overloaded with too much water, it can lead to clogging and failure. To prevent this, it is important to be mindful of your water usage and avoid overloading the system. Simple measures like fixing leaky faucets and toilets can help conserve water and prevent unnecessary strain on the drainfield. Additionally, spreading out your water usage throughout the day and avoiding excessive water use during peak times can also help prevent drainfield damage.
By being mindful of your water consumption and taking steps to conserve water, you can ensure that your drainfield remains clog-free and functional for years to come.
A clogged drainfield exhibits warning signs such as slow draining fixtures, foul odors, and pooling water. These indicators suggest underlying drainfield problems and necessitate prompt attention to prevent further damage to the septic system.
Septic tank additives are commonly used to prevent drainfield problems. However, the effectiveness of such additives in maintaining the drainfield remains uncertain. Further research is needed to determine their true impact on drainfield maintenance.
Septic tank maintenance is crucial to prevent drainfield issues. Regular pumping is recommended, typically every 3 to 5 years, depending on the household size and usage. Signs of drainfield failure include slow drains, odors, and pooling water.
Using the wrong cleaning products in your septic system can lead to potential damage. Harsh chemicals, antibacterial soaps, and bleach can disrupt the natural balance of bacteria, hindering the system’s ability to break down waste effectively.
Heavy rain and flooding can lead to drainfield problems by saturating the soil and causing system overload. To prevent these issues, maintain a well-functioning septic system, divert excessive rainwater away from the drainfield, and avoid compacting the soil.
